The Proform 695 Elliptical is one of Proform’s ultra-affordable, new folding elliptical trainers.

It’s a step up from the Proform 495 model with a heavier flywheel and more resistance levels.

Plus it gives you incline to add extra crosstraining to your workout – another option the Proform 495 model does not have.

The Proform Smart Strider 695 also folds up easily and stores away to save you space, which makes it a great choice for smaller workout areas, apartments or condos.

So is the Proform 695 elliptical a good choice for you?

Here’s a review of what you need to know before you buy:

Proform 695 Specs:

Price: $799 + Free Shipping

Strider: 18 inches

Resistance Levels: 20

iFit? Yes

Weight Capacity: 300 lbs

Built-In Workouts: 24

Warranty: Lifetime Frame Warranty, 2-Year Parts Warranty, and 1-Year Labor Warranty

Proform 695 Elliptical Review –  Key Benefits:

 

Folds Up To Save Space

Like all the Smart Stride ellipticals, the 695 was made so you could easily fold it up and move it out of the way. There are wheels on the bottom to help you roll it away.

It can even be stored in a closet. So it’s a great choice for smaller workout areas like condos or apartments.

 

 

proform smart strider 695 elliptical review

 

 

Incline For Extra Calorie-Burning

Incline changes the slope of your elliptical pathway, helping you to work different muscle groups and get a more optimal workout overall.

The Proform 695 elliptical gives you from 0 – 10 degree adjustable incline so you can focus on specific muscle groups. You can target your glutes, quads, and calves for realistic trail training.

 

 

Heavy 18 Pound Flywheel

A heavier flywheel gives you a smoother feeling ride without all the jerky stop-and-start motions of cheaper machines. The Proform 695 has a heavy 18 pound flywheel – a step up from the 13 pound flywheel on the Proform 495 model.

This also helps it to withstand longer, more intense workouts. It also helps to anchor the machine for added stability.

Proform 695 Elliptical Review – What You Should Know:

 

No Backlit Console

The console is fairly simple on this elliptical and it’s not backlit. Also, if you want to get the full effect of iFit (watching the scenery of world trails as you run), you’ll need to use your tablet to do it.

 

 

proform smart strider 695 elliptical trainer review

 

 

Manual Incline

The incline on this trainer is not power incline, meaning you can’t adjust it from the console. You have to get off the trainer to do it. It’s a small thing and most people probably won’t care – but it’s something to be aware of.

If you want a folding elliptical with power incline and a full-color touch screen console, you’ll want to check out the next model up – the Proform 895 Smart Strider elliptical.

 

 

Bottom Line?

The Proform 695 elliptical is a new folding model that feels extremely sturdy and strong.

Unlike many of the cheaper folding ellipticals on the market, this trainer is built with more substance to it – using a heavy 18 pound flywheel and a commercial gauge steel frame.

So even though it folds up, it still won’t shake or wobble when you pick up the pace during your workout.

You also get some luxuries to add to your workouts like the incline option or the iFit Coach that lets you run trails all over the world. If you want a folding elliptical that is strong enough to take heavy, intense workouts, the Proform 695 is worth considering.
